" Requiring modernisation is this pleasant three bedroom semi detached home which is located within a highly desirable road within Bromley South. The accommodation comprises of entrance hall, two reception rooms, whilst upstairs there are three bedrooms and bathroom, the property does benefit from double glazing and offers gas central heating. Outside there is also a garden which requires attention. The location is within 0.4 of a mile from Bromley South where you can find the mainline station serving London Victoria as well as the Glades Shopping centre where you will find a host of first class shopping and leisure facilities, also close by are highly desirable schools including Bickley and Raglan Primary. Viewings come highly recommended as this property is a fantastic opportunity for someone looking to make their own. Chain free.

ENTRANCE HALLWAY Frosted window to front, picture rail, under stairs storage cupboard, radiator. RECEPTION ROOM 13'05 X 11'01 (4.09m X 3.38m) Double glazed window to front, picture rail, radiator. RECEPTION ROOM 17'11 X 11'0 (5.46m X 3.35m) Double glazed patio doors to rear and window to side, picture rail, fireplace with wooden surround and tiled hearth, storage cupboard housing electric meters, radiator. KITCHEN 8'01 X 4'11 (2.46m X 1.50m) Double glazed door to side and window to rear, wall mounted boiler, a range of fitted wall and base units with work-surface over, stainless steel sink and drainer with mixer taps, space for cooker, plumbed for washing machine. FIRST FLOOR LANDING Frosted window to side, doors to: BEDROOM 1 12'06 X 11'01 (3.81m X 3.38m) Double glazed window to front, picture rail, radiator. BEDROOM 2 12'06 X 11'01 (3.81m X 3.38m) Double glazed window to rear, picture rail, radiator. BEDROOM 3 8'0 X 7'06 (2.44m X 2.29m) Double glazed window to front, picture rail, picture rail, radiator. BATHROOM 7'01 X 5'09 (2.16m X 1.75m) Frosted double glazed window to rear, pedestal wash hand basin, panel enclosed bath with mixer taps and wall mounted shower over, tiled walls radiator. SEPARATE WC 3'11 X 2'08 (1.19m X 0.81m) Frosted double glazed window to side, high level flush WC. REAR GARDEN 80'0 (24.38m) Laid to lawn with storage shed.
